如何使用微博开放平台API进行数据挖掘?

在当今信息爆炸的时代,社交媒体已成为人们获取信息、交流观点的重要平台。微博作为中国最大的社交媒体之一,拥有庞大的用户群体和丰富的数据资源。那么,如何利用微博开放平台API进行数据挖掘呢?本文将为您详细解析。

一、了解微博开放平台API

微博开放平台API是微博提供的一套面向开发者的接口,允许开发者获取微博平台上的数据。通过这些API,开发者可以获取微博用户信息、微博内容、话题、评论等数据,进行数据挖掘和分析。

二、数据挖掘步骤

  1. 注册微博开放平台账号:首先,您需要在微博开放平台注册一个账号,并获取App Key和App Secret。

  2. 申请API权限:登录微博开放平台,进入开发者中心,申请所需API的权限。根据您的需求,可以申请用户信息、微博内容、话题、评论等API。

  3. 编写API请求代码:使用HTTP请求方法,如GET或POST,向微博开放平台发送API请求。在请求中,您需要提供App Key、App Secret以及访问令牌(Access Token)。

  4. 获取数据:根据API返回的数据格式,解析并提取所需信息。例如,您可以通过API获取特定用户的微博内容,分析其发布频率、话题偏好等。

  5. 数据分析和挖掘:利用Python、Java等编程语言,对获取的数据进行清洗、处理和分析。您可以使用文本挖掘、情感分析、聚类分析等方法,挖掘出有价值的信息。

三、案例分析

以下是一个简单的案例分析:

假设您想分析某位明星的微博粉丝群体特征。首先,通过微博开放平台API获取该明星的粉丝列表。然后,对粉丝的性别、年龄、地域、关注领域等数据进行统计和分析。通过分析结果,您可以了解到该明星的粉丝群体以哪些人群为主,为后续的市场推广提供参考。

四、总结

利用微博开放平台API进行数据挖掘,可以帮助您深入了解用户需求、市场趋势等,为您的业务决策提供有力支持。掌握微博API的使用方法,并运用合适的数据挖掘技术,将为您带来意想不到的收获。

猜你喜欢:聊天app开发源码